In 2016, Mediengruppe Pressedruck Germany implemented SAP S/4 HANA as its core ERP Financial platform, migrating from SAP ERP ECC 6.0 to consolidate transactional finance and commercial operations. The deployment positioned SAP S/4 HANA to support finance-led processes and to align customer and contract data under the SAP business partner area model. Configuration work centered on financial management capabilities typical of ERP Financial deployments, including general ledger, accounts payable, accounts receivable, and period-end close controls, alongside commercial configuration in SAP SD for order-to-cash execution. The implementation explicitly incorporated the SAP business partner area to unify customer and vendor master data and used SAP SD configuration to handle sales order processing, pricing, and billing workflows. Integration scope included a connection to Hybris for commerce and front-end customer engagement, enabling order capture and catalog interactions in Hybris to flow into SAP SD for fulfillment and invoicing. Master data synchronization was handled through the SAP business partner area to ensure consistent customer records across SAP S/4 HANA and the Hybris commerce layer, preserving order lifecycle integrity between sales and finance functions. Governance changes emphasized centralized master data stewardship using the business partner model and tightened alignment between sales and finance workflows, particularly order-to-cash and billing reconciliation. Rollout and operational ownership focused on embedding SAP S/4 HANA into group finance and sales operations, with configuration and process rationalization to support ongoing ERP Financial operations.

In 2017 Mediengruppe Pressedruck Germany deployed In-House ATS, an in-house Applicant Tracking System, to centralize recruiting and applicant intake for its HR and Talent Acquisition teams. The In-House ATS is provisioned as an internal application and is embedded on the company careers site pd-karriere.de to publish job postings and capture candidate applications directly from the public site. Configuration emphasized core Applicant Tracking System capabilities, including job posting management, candidate intake and profile storage, configurable recruitment workflows, and automated candidate communications. The implementation aligns with typical ATS functional modules for requisition control, screening queues and interview scheduling, with configuration focused on web-to-application forms and centralized candidate records. Operational coverage includes HR business functions and hiring managers across Mediengruppe Pressedruck Germany, with the In-House ATS serving as the primary system of record for applicant data and recruitment workflows. Governance introduced standardized review stages and centralized application handling to streamline hiring processes, while the public careers site integration ensures continuous capture of external applicants via pd-karriere.de.

In 2024, Mediengruppe Pressedruck implemented Stibo CUE Hive as the Collaboration platform component of a consolidated media delivery strategy. The deployment included Stibo CUE Content Store and CUE DAM as the core of the pd platform to centralize content creation and accelerate digital publishing across multiple regional brands in Germany. The project went live on July 3, 2024 and targeted newsroom teams and multi-brand editorial workflows. Configuration emphasized content lifecycle management, digital asset management, and editorial collaboration, using Stibo CUE Hive for shared workspaces, version control, and editorial task orchestration. CUE Content Store and CUE DAM provided centralized metadata management, asset ingestion, and delivery pipelines aligned with website and digital channels. The implementation leveraged Collaboration category capabilities such as workflow orchestration, permissions based editorial governance, and coordinated publishing handoffs. Operational scope covered multiple regional brands within Germany and consolidated newsroom operations under the pd platform to reduce fragmentation in content creation and publication sequencing. Governance changes introduced centralized editorial standards and role based content ownership to support cross brand reuse and coordinated publishing schedules. The launch improved newsroom collaboration and sped up multi brand digital delivery as reported by the vendor.

Mediengruppe Pressedruck Germany is a Media organization based in Germany, with around 4000 employees and annual revenues of $516.0 million.
Mediengruppe Pressedruck Germany operates a diverse technology stack with applications such as SAP S/4 HANA, In-House ATS and Stibo CUE Hive, covering areas like ERP Financial, Applicant Tracking System and Collaboration.
Mediengruppe Pressedruck Germany has invested in cloud applications and AI-driven platforms to optimize efficiency and growth, collaborating with vendors such as SAP, In-House Applications and Stibo DX.
Mediengruppe Pressedruck Germany recently adopted applications including Stibo CUE Hive in 2024, Microsoft Azure Cloud Services in 2021 and Hornetsecurity Zerospam in 2018, highlighting its ongoing modernization strategy.
